Best Areas for Military Families Relocating to Destin
Niceville
Highly regarded for its exceptional schools and immediate proximity to Eglin Air Force Base, Niceville remains a premier destination for military families who prioritize a peaceful, family-friendly, community-focused lifestyle.
Shalimar
Shalimar provides a strategic location with effortless commutes to both Eglin AFB and Hurlburt Field, featuring mature neighborhoods and a deeply rooted military presence. Shalimar is home to some of the best waterfront options in the area and is in close proximity to the public airport.
Fort Walton Beach
This area is a top choice for military buyers looking for affordability, minimized commute times, and the convenience of being situated between military bases and the Emerald Coast beaches.
Destin
For those seeking a high-end coastal experience, Destin offers world-class water sports, white-sand beaches, and luxury living while maintaining a manageable commute for service members.
Navarre
Navarre is increasingly popular for its laid-back coastal atmosphere and modern housing developments, offering a perfect balance for families stationed at Hurlburt Field. Additionally, it is a quick commute into Pensacola for local shopping, dining, and entertainment such as concerts, minor league Blue Wahoos Baseball, and hockey!
Best Communities for Buyers Relocating to the Emerald Coast
Destin
Destin is known for luxury coastal living, watersport activities, golf courses, waterfront communities, and a vacation-style atmosphere. Buyers love the access to beaches, marinas, dining, and high-end homes. It’s ideal for luxury buyers, second-home owners, and those wanting an upscale coastal lifestyle. Pricing is typically higher due to waterfront demand and location.
Niceville
Niceville offers a quieter, family-friendly environment with highly rated schools and close proximity to Eglin Air Force Base. The area is popular with military families, professionals, and full-time residents seeking strong community feel and long-term stability. Home prices are generally more moderate than Destin.
Miramar Beach
Miramar Beach blends resort-style living with strong vacation rental and investment opportunities. Buyers are drawn to gated communities, golf courses, beach access, and luxury condos. It’s a great fit for second-home buyers, investors, and those wanting a balance between lifestyle and rental income potential.
30A
The 30A area is known for luxury coastal communities, walkability, boutique shopping, and elevated beach-town charm. Communities along 30A attract buyers seeking a high-end lifestyle, scenic beauty, and strong long-term appreciation. The area continues to grow and pricing tends to be among the highest on the Emerald Coast.
Fort Walton Beach
Fort Walton Beach offers more affordability while still providing easy access to beaches, shopping, and nearby military bases. The area is especially popular with military families, first-time buyers, and those prioritizing commute times and value.

Biggest Mistakes People Make When Relocating to Destin
Underestimating Insurance Costs
Flood insurance, wind coverage, and coastal property insurance premiums fluctuate significantly based on specific flood zone designations and proximity to the water.
Choosing the Wrong Neighborhood
Each community along the Emerald Coast provides a distinct lifestyle, ranging from secluded residential enclaves to high-energy, tourism-driven seasonal hubs.
Ignoring Traffic Patterns
Seasonal congestion can dramatically alter your daily routine. Commute times shift heavily depending on your location and the current tourist volume.
Overlooking Short-Term Rental Restrictions
It is a frequent mistake to assume rentals are universal. Strict HOA regulations and local zoning often limit your ability to capitalize on investment opportunities.
Hesitating in a Fast-Paced Market
Premium listings in Destin's top neighborhoods move quickly, particularly during peak relocation windows and military PCS cycles when demand is highest.

What is the best area near Eglin AFB?
Niceville is often considered one of the best areas near Eglin Air Force Base due to its top-rated schools, shorter commute times, and family-oriented neighborhoods. Fort Walton Beach and Shalimar are also popular choices for military families.
How competitive is the Destin housing market?
The Destin market can be highly competitive, especially for waterfront homes, investment properties, and homes in desirable school zones. Inventory levels, seasonality, and buyer demand can all impact competition and pricing.
Do I need flood insurance in Destin?
Flood insurance requirements depend on the property location and flood zone designation. Many homes near the coast or waterfront areas may require flood insurance, while others may not. A local relocation realtor can help buyers understand insurance costs and risk factors before purchasing.
What should military families know before relocating?
Military families relocating to the Emerald Coast should consider commute times, school districts, VA loan options, resale potential, and future rental flexibility. Working with a realtor experienced in PCS moves and military relocation can make the process significantly smoother.
When is the best time to move to Destin?
The best time to relocate often depends on your goals. Spring and Summer are popular due to school semesters and increased inventory, while Fall and Winter may offer less competition and smoother moving conditions. Military PCS timing can also influence relocation schedules.
